This role is remote from CA, OR, WA, CO, GA, VA, MD, HI and D.C. only The Program Manager IV reports to the Director, Security Risk Management, Education & Engagement. This role will be responsible for the development and driving of strategic, enterprise-wide, cross-regional, security related engagement and training campaigns & programs for KP. This position will oversee the development of a wide range of content to support many functions within our National Security Services team, ranging from enterprise security risk management efforts, security education and engagement for KP employees and physician partners, and more. This position requires strong organizational skills, as well as strong interpersonal and collaborative communication skills to ensure organizational alignment and that stakeholder needs are met.
